The Paris Peace Treaty, signed in 1783, involved representatives from the United States, Great Britain, France, and Spain. The key American negotiators were Benjamin Franklin, John Jay, and John Adams, while British representatives included David Hartley. The treaty officially ended the American Revolutionary War, recognizing American independence and establishing boundaries for the new nation. Additionally, France and Spain were involved as allies of the United States, influencing negotiations and outcomes.
